ALERT: Migration drift detected on the Copperline production database. The zero-downtime migrator (Shimstack) paused mid-expand phase; old and new schema versions are both live. Traffic is unaffected, but do not ship releases that assume the contracted schema. Check the dual-write flag status before approving any deploy. If the pause exceeds 30 minutes, page the Datamoor rotation. The resume-or-rollback decision tree is on the internal page linked below.

operations page: https://jenkins.zemvarcloud.local/job/merge_requests/repo/build/73930b4b30f0a8ed

Handover Note — Director to Director

For the sales leads: I am handing over the decision on hedging our dornmark receivables from the Quillen accounts. We locked 60% coverage through year-end; the remainder floats pending the Averlane renewal. Please quote in hedged rates only. Context on why appears in the confidential note below.

management briefing: Project Ulavan slips by two quarters because of the staffing delay.

### Mail Room Relocation — Night Shift Notes

The mail room has moved from the ground floor of Tarwick House to Level 1, beside the goods lift. Night shift staff sorting overnight deliveries should use the Level 1 entrance only, as the old room is now a storage area and its lock has been decommissioned. Trolleys stay inside the new room overnight. The access code for the relocated mail room door is below.

staff pass of kawip-hawef = bdg-QLP-2